For scholarships and prizes open to undergraduates in all faculties, see "Open to Students in Most Faculties", section 3.2.3. To be eligible, a student must have successfully completed at least 27 graded credits in the academic year preceding the award and must register as a full-time student during the subsequent year, unless fewer credits are needed to complete the program. Students whose records contain outstanding incompletes or deferrals will not be considered.Established in 1996 by family and friends of Duncan Campbell, a highly esteemed graduate of the Faculty of Music and a multifaceted musician, who played a leading role in the life of the community as singer, organist, and choral musician, culminating his career as stage manager of L'Opéra de Montréal. Awarded by the Schulich School of Music Scholarships Committee to a Voice student who demonstrates a particular interest in the art song and oratorio repertoire.
Value: $1,200.Established in 2011 by friends and family in memory of David “Slide” Cohen, B.A. 1952, long-time member of the Schulich School of Music Advisory Board and McGill Governor. A menswear manufacturer by profession, David was a music lover at heart. As a student he played drums and trumpet and also managed the McGill Redmen Marching Band. Upon retirement, David studied trombone with a student at the Music faculty. Awarded by the Schulich School of Music Scholarships Committee with preference given to an outstanding brass student in the Schulich School of Music.
